How much do software development associate j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for software development associate in Spring, TX is $47,536.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$37,800.00 and $53,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ges software development associates face when transitioning from academic projects to professional work?

Software Development Associates often find that real-world projects involve more collaboration, code reviews, and adherence to coding standards than academic assignments. In a professional setting, there is also a greater emphasis on version control, agile methodologies, and communicating progress with team members and stakeholders. Balancing multiple tasks and deadlines, learning to navigate legacy codebases, and quickly adapting to new tools or frameworks are frequent challenges, but they also provide valuable opportunities for growth and skill development.

What is a software development associate?

A Software Development Associate is an entry-level professional who assists in designing, coding, testing, and maintaining software applications. They work closely with more experienced developers and project teams to help build and improve software solutions according to specifications. Their tasks often include debugging code, writing documentation, and participating in code reviews. This role is ideal for recent graduates or those new to the software development field, providing foundational experience and growth op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a software development associ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Software Development Associate,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as Java, Python, or C++), problem-solving abilities, and a relevant bachelor's deg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, integrated development environments (IDEs), and agile development methodologies is typically expected. Strong teamwork, communication skills, and a willingness to learn new technologies set standout candidates apart. These skills and qualities enable associates to effectively contribute to projects, adapt to evolving requirements, and collaborate within dynamic development teams.

Title: Cyber Security Architect 
Location: Spring, TX 77389 (Hybrid: 3 days onsite / 2 days remote)
Duration: Long Term Contract 
Work Requirements: , Holders or Authorized to Work in the U.S. 


Job Description

Cyber Security Architect is a key member of the IT Cyber Security team responsible for helping design, implement, and enhance enterprise security solutions that protect digital assets, systems, applications, and data. This role is ideal for a strong cybersecurity professional with a solid technical foundation who is ready to expand into broader security architecture responsibilities while partnering closely with senior leadership and engineering teams.
The position will focus on strengthening application security, secure software development practices, cloud security, and DevSecOps while providing opportunities to grow into enterprise architecture, strategic planning, and technical leadership.
This role is well suited for someone with strong hands-on cybersecurity experience who is looking to take the next step in their career.
What You Will Do
Security Engineering & Architecture

  • Assist in designing and implementing enterprise security architectures across cloud, on-premise, hybrid, and application environments.
  • Participate in architecture reviews for applications, infrastructure, SaaS platforms, and cloud solutions to ensure alignment with cybersecurity standards and risk management practices.
  • Work alongside senior architects and engineering teams to continuously improve IT security posture.
Application Security
  • Support secure application design by promoting secure coding practices, application security standards, and security-by-design principles.
  • Collaborate with Enterprise Architecture and Development teams to ensure applications are built on secure and scalable platforms.
Secure Software Development
  • Partner with development teams to integrate security throughout the Software Development Lifecycle (SDLC).
  • Participate in threat modeling, code reviews, vulnerability remediation, and application security testing.
DevSecOps
  • Assist with implementing DevSecOps practices by integrating security into CI/CD pipelines.
  • Support automated security testing, code scanning, dependency analysis, and vulnerability management.
Risk & Governance
  • Identify and assess cybersecurity risks affecting applications, cloud platforms, APIs, and infrastructure.
  • Support security assessments and ensure solutions align with company policies and industry best practices.
Collaboration
  • Work closely with developers, infrastructure engineers, cloud teams, and project managers to implement practical security solutions.
  • Participate in security reviews for new technologies and business initiatives.
  • Continuous Improvement
  • Stay current on emerging cybersecurity threats, technologies, and industry trends.
  • Recommend improvements to security tools, processes, and controls.
  • Continue developing technical expertise and gradually assume greater architecture responsibilities.
What You Will Need
Education & Experience
  • Bachelor''s degree in Computer Science, Information Security, Cybersecurity, Information Technology, or a related field (or equivalent experience).
  • 4–7 years of cybersecurity experience in one or more of the following areas:
    • Security Engineering
    • Security Operations
    • Application Security
    • Cloud Security
    • Azure Platform
    • Infrastructure Security
    • DevSecOps
  • Experience supporting enterprise environments and collaborating with infrastructure and development teams.
  • Strong desire to grow into cybersecurity architecture and technical leadership responsibilities.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ills.
Preferred:
  • Experience within regulated industries such as energy, maritime, manufacturing, or financial services.
  • Experience working in Agile environments.
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
  • Strong understanding of cybersecurity fundamentals and enterprise security concepts.
  • Working knowledge of security frameworks including NIST CSF, CIS Controls, ISO 27001, and OWASP.
  • Experience with vulnerability management, endpoint security, identity and access management (IAM), network security, and cloud security.
  • Familiarity with secure software development and DevSecOps concepts.
  • Experience using security tools such as vulnerability scanners, SIEM platforms, endpoint protection, or cloud security solutions.
  • Understanding of SAST, DAST, Software Composition Analysis (SCA), or similar application security tools is preferred but not required.
  • Basic understanding of CI/CD pipelines and secure development practices.
  • Ability to analyze security risks and recommend practical solutions.
  • Strong troubleshooting, documentation, and communication skills.
  • Professional certifications such as Security+, CISSP (Associate), GSEC, SSCP, Azure Security Engineer or similar certifications are a plus but not required.
